An IT provider is doing its job when you stop worrying about day-to-day IT.
That is the test. If you are chasing tickets, re-explaining your environment to a new technician, or discovering that a backup was never restore-tested, the arrangement has failed — regardless of what the SLA says.
We keep engagements small enough that the same engineers know your environment. We document what we build. And we hand you the keys: every configuration, credential and runbook is yours, not held hostage.

Every environment we run gets the same baseline, because we are also the security firm: hardened configurations, MFA and least privilege, patching on a defined cycle, monitored logs, tested restores, and documentation an auditor can read. One distinction we keep honest: “we reply within one business day” on the contact page is for new inquiries. Support response times for managed clients are separate, faster, and written into the agreement — acknowledgment, response and mitigation are three different clocks.
